Kyrie Irving’s NBA Journey: A Quick Recap
Kyrie Andrew Irving, born in 1992 in Melbourne, Australia, has made a significant mark in the NBA. Drafted as the first overall pick in 2011 by the Cleveland Cavaliers, Irving quickly became a household name. His pivotal role in the Cavaliers’ 2016 NBA Championship win cemented his legacy. Known for his precision three-point shooting and ankle-breaking dribbles, Irving has consistently impressed fans worldwide.
Over the years, Irving has played for several NBA teams, including the Boston Celtics and Brooklyn Nets. His career is characterised by a mix of exceptional performances and occasional controversies.
